Dillon, Stuart place fourth in morning consolation finals

3/20/2004 12:00:00 AM | Men's Wrestling

St. Louis, MO – At this point in the NCAA Tournament, with only a few matches remaining, teams are jockeying to get as many points as possible in hopes of a top finish.  Saturday morning, Lehigh did their best to make a move, winning three matches to move closer and closer to a potential top three finish.  Going into Saturday night’s finals, the Mountain Hawks trail Iowa by 4.5 points for second and are tied with Ohio State for third with 73.5 points.

 

In the consolation semis, Mario Stuart and Brad Dillon each won close victories in overtime to move into the third place matches.  Stuart defeated Vic Moreno of Cal-Poly 4-2 in the first tie break, while Dillon rode out Ryan Lange of Purdue in the second tie-break to win 2-1.

 

However, both of them would come up against very tough opponents in the 3rd place bouts, with Sam Hazewinkel of Oklahoma beating Stuart for the second time at the NCAAs, this time by a 9-1 major decision.  Dillon faced Tyler Nixt of Iowa, and Nixt looked very sharp as he took third 9-3. Both Stuart and Dillon finished a career-best fourth as they cap off very successful Lehigh careers.

 

In the 7th place matches, Cory Cooperman dominated Coyte Cooper of Indiana, winning 7th place by a 7-1 final.  Travis Frick fought hard, but came up one takedown shy as he fell 4-3 to Kurt Backes of Iowa State to finish 8th.
